MST20722

Certificate II in Apparel, Fashion and Textiles in Port Macquarie

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)
Study mode On Campus / Blended
Duration 4 months
Estimated fee* $9,340
* Fees are indicative only and vary based on your circumstances and eligibility for government funding.

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ements
  •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

The course links to a variety of career pathways within the industry, including roles such as Retail Assistant and Fashion Design Assistant. Gaining a Certificate II qualification enhances your employability in sectors related to Retail, Manufacturing, and Creative Arts, Fashion and Music. Each area offers unique opportunities that allow you to engage with various aspects of apparel production and retail, fostering a diverse skill set.

By enrolling in the Certificate II in Apparel, Fashion and Textiles, you will learn skills that prepare you for roles such as a Sewing Machinist or Production Worker. These positions are integral to the fashion industry, where precision and creativity are paramount. Additional job opportunities also include Production Assistant and Wardrobe Assistant, both of which contribute significantly to the smooth operation of production processes in fashion and textiles.
